|
@@ -276,13 +276,13 @@ class globCL(GCLMixin):
|
276
|
276
|
await asyncio.sleep(self.timeout)
|
277
|
277
|
def _run_persistent_loop2(self,*a,**kw):
|
278
|
278
|
p("_run_persistent_loop2:",self,a,kw)
|
279
|
|
- self.run_persistent_loop = nop
|
|
279
|
+ self.run_persistent_loop2 = nop
|
280
|
280
|
self.rman.persistent_loop_cb()
|
281
|
|
- loop = asyncio.get_event_loop()
|
282
|
|
- loop.create_task(self.persistent_loop())
|
|
281
|
+ # loop = asyncio.get_event_loop()
|
283
|
282
|
# loop.create_task(self.persistent_fast_cb_loop())
|
284
|
|
- loop.create_task(self.persistent_fast_cb_loop_min_timeout())
|
285
|
|
- self.loop = loop
|
|
283
|
+ asyncio.ensure_future(self.persistent_loop())
|
|
284
|
+ asyncio.ensure_future(self.persistent_fast_cb_loop_min_timeout())
|
|
285
|
+ # self.loop = loop
|
286
|
286
|
|
287
|
287
|
def _run_persistent_loop(self,*a,**kw):
|
288
|
288
|
p("_run_persistent_loop:",self,a,kw)
|